单选题In the following essay, each blank has four choices. Choose the best answer and write down on the answer sheet. Spread spectrum simply means that data is sent in small pieces over a number of the (16) frequencies available for use at any time in the specified range. Devices using (17) spread spectrum(DSSS) communicate by (18) each byte of data into several parts and sending them concurrently on different (19) . DSSS uses a lot of the available (20) , about 22 megahertz(MHz).
单选题客户/服务器模式产生于20世纪
27
上年代,它是基于
28
的要求而发展起来的。客户/服务器模式的第一个软件产品是
29
系统,客户/服务器模式通常在
30
环境下运行,客户端的软件具有
31
。
单选题某项目制订的开发计划中定义了3个任务,其中任务A首先开始,且需要3周完成,任务B必须在任务A启动1周后开始,且需要2周完成,任务C必须在任务A完成后才能开始,且需要2周完成。该项目的进度安排可用下面的甘特图______来描述。
问答题虚拟局域网(Virtual LAN)是一种不用路由器,而由第三层交换机来实现广播数据的抑制的方案。是在交换网络环境中实现的。虚拟局域网技术和第三层交换技术一样,都是近年发展起来的一种网络新技术,这种新技术提高了网络管理效率、安全性、控制广播的能力。虚拟局域网(VLAN:Virtual Local Area Network):根据功能、应用等因素将不同物理位置的用户从逻辑上划分(与物理位置无关)为一个个功能相对独立、广播相互隔离的工作组或广播域。
问答题阅读以下说明,回答下面问题。【说明】某公司下设三个部门,为了便于管理,每个部门组成一个VLAN,公司网络结构如图2.3所示。
问答题下面的命令在路由器router-a中配置了相应的IPSec策略,请说明该策略的含义。 router-a(config)#crypto policy p1 router-a(config-policy)# flow 192.168.8.0 255.255.255.0 192.168.9.255.255.255.255.0 ip tunnel tun1 router-a(config-policy)#exit
问答题/*simple ping program*/
struct sockaddr_in saddr;
int rawsock;
unsigned short in_cksum(unsigned short*addr, int len)
{ int sum=0;
unsigned short res=0;
while(1en>1){
sum+=*addr++; len-=2;
}
if(len=1){
*((unsigned char *)( sum+=res;
}
sum=(sum>>16)+(sam
sum+=(sum>>16); res=~sum;
return res;
}
void ping(int signo)
{
int len;
int i;
static unsigned short seq=0;
char buff[8192];
struct timeval tv;
struet icmp*icmph=(struct icmp * )buff;
long*data=(long*)icmph→icmp_data;
bzero(buff, 8192);
gettimeofday(
icmph→icmp_type=ICMP_ECHO;
icmph→icmp_code=0;
icmph→icmp_cksum=0;
icmph→icmp_id=0;
icmph→icmp_seq=0;
icmph→icmp_id=getpid()
icmph→icmp_seq=seq++;
data[0]=tv.tv_sec;
data[1]=tv.tv_usec;
for(i=8; i< ; i++)
icmph→icmp_data[i]=(unsigned char)i;
icmph→icmp_cksum=in_cksum((unsigned short *)buff, ? 72);
len; sendto(rawsock, buff, 72, 0,
alarm(1);
}
void sigint(int signo)
{ printf("CATCH SIGINT !!! /n");
close(rawsock);
exit(0);
}
void dumppkt(char*buf, int len)
{ struct ip*iph=(struct ip*)buf;
int i=iph→ip_h1*4;
struct icmp*icmph=(struct icmp*)
long*data=(long*)iemph→icmp_data;
struct timeval tv;
gettimeofday(
if(icmph→icmp_type! =ICMP_ECHOREPLY)
return;
if(icmph→icmp_id! =(getpid()
printf("From %s:ttl=% d seq=% d time=%.2f ms/n",
inet_ntoa(iph→ip_src),iph→ip_ttl?,
icmph→icmp_seq,
(tv.tv_see-data[0])*1000.0+(tv.tv_usec-data[0])/1000.0);
}
int main(int argc, char*argv[])
{ int len;
stuct timeval now;
char recvbuff[8192];
if{{U}}(1){{/U}}{
printf("%s aaa.bbb.ccc.ddd/n", argv[0]);
exit(1);
}
rawsock=soeket(AF_INET, {{U}}(2){{/U}}, IPPROTO_ICMP);
if(rawsock<0) {
perror("soeket");
exit(1);
}
bzero (
saddr.sin_family={{U}}(3){{/U}};
if( inet_aton( argv[1],
exit(1);
}
signal(SICALRM, ping);
signal(SICINT, sigint);
alarm(1);
while (1){
len=read {{U}}(4){{/U}}, recvbuff, 8192);
if( len<0
else it( len<0)
perror("read");
else if( len>0)
dumppkt(recvbuff, len);
}
close {{U}}(5){{/U}};
exit(0);
}
问答题若备选设备有光网络单元(ONU)、光收发器和交换机,为图17-2中A、B、C选择正确的设备。
问答题【配置路由器信息】
Current configuration:
!
version 11.3
no service password-encryption
!
{{U}}hostname router5{{/U}} 第(1)处
!
{{U}}enable password nwdl2345{{/U}} 第(2)处
!
interface Ethernet0
{{U}}ip address 192.4.1.1.255.255.255.0{{/U}} 第(3)处
!
interface Seria10
ip address 192.3.1.1 255.255.255.0
encapsulation frame-rocay IETF
no ip mroute-cache
bandwidth 2000 第(4)处
{{U}}frame-relaymanin 192.3.1.2100 broadcast{{/U}} 第(5)处
frame-relaylmi-typecisco
!
{{U}}router ospfl{{/U}} 第(6)处
{{U}}netword 192.1.1.0.0.0.0.255 area0{{/U}} 第(7)处
network 192.3.1.0.0.0.0.255 area0
network 192.4.1.0.0.0.0.255 area0
{{U}}neighbor 192.1.1.2{{/U}} 第(8)处
!
End
问答题
某公司设置VPN服务器允许外地的公司员工通过Internet连接到公司内部网络。
问答题下面的命令是在路由器router-a中配置IPSec隧道。请完成下面的隧道配置命令。 router-a (config)# crypto tunnel tun1 (设置IPSec隧道名称为tun1) router-a (config-tunnel)#peer address (3) (设置隧道对端IP地址) router-a (config-tunnel)#local address (4) (设置隧道本端Ip地址) router-a (config-tunnel)#set auto-up (设置为自动协商) router-a (config—tunnel)#exit (退出隧道设置)
问答题阅读以下有关网络设备安装与调试的叙述,分析设备配置文件,回答下面问题。
下面以一台远程访问服务器(RAS)Cisco 2509、RJ45为例来说明。
第一步,准备安装与调试所需的设备。 第二步,硬件连接,RJ45直通线一头插入Cisco
2509的console口,另一头接RJ45转9针串口转换器,再将转换器接到计算机的串口。
第三步,RAS加电,调用超级终端程序进行设备连接,进入Cisco设备的虚拟操作台。 第四步,输入Cisco
2509的IOS配置命令。 第五步,将调试完毕的设备连入本地网络,通过拨号验证配置是否正确。
问答题DNS服务器1负责本网络区域的域名解析,对于非本网络的域名,可以通过设置“转发器”,将自己无法解析的名称转到网络C中的DNS服务器2进行解析。设置步骤:首先在“DNS管理器”中选中DNS服务器,单击鼠标右键,选择“属性”对话框中的“转发器”选项卡,在弹出的如图18-40所示的对话框中应如何配置?
问答题【说明】
代码实例中的服务器通过socket连接向客户端发送字符串"Hello,you are connected!"。只要在服务器上运行该服务器软件,在客户端运行客户软件,客户端就会收到该字符串。
客户端程序代码如下:
#include<stdio.h>
#include<stdlib.h>
#include<errno.h>
#include<string.h>
#include<netdb.h>
#include<sys/types.h>
#include<netinet/in.h>
#include<sys/socket.h>
#define SERVPORT 3333
#define MAXDATASIZE 100 /*每次最大数据传输量*/
main(int argc, char*argv[]){
int sockfd, recvbytes;
char buf[MAXDATASIZE];
stmct hostent*host;
struct sockaddr_in serv_addr;
if {{U}}(1){{/U}} {
fprintf(stderr, "Please enter the server's hostname!/n");
exit(1);
}
if<(host=gethostbyname(argv[1]))=NULL) {
herror("gethostbyname出错!");
exit(1);
}
if ((sockfd = socket(AF_INET, {{U}}(2){{/U}}, 0))=-1) {
perror("socket创建出错!");
exit(1);
}
serv_addr.sin_family=AF_INET;
serv_addr.sin_port=htons(SERVPORT);
Serv_addr.sin_addr=*((structin_addr*)host→h_addr);
bzero(
if(connect {{U}}(3){{/U}}, (struct sockaddr *)
exit(1);
}
if((recvbytes=recv {{U}}(4){{/U}}, buf, MAXDATASIZE, 0))=-1) {
perror("recv出错!");
exit(1);
}
buf[recvbytes]='/0';
pfintf("Received: %s", buf);
close(sockfd);
}
问答题
随着Internet的发展,用户对网络带宽的要求不断提高,传统的接入网已成为整个网络中的瓶颈,以新的宽带接入技术取而代之已成为目前研究的焦点。其中最引人注意的是光纤接入技术。
问答题
结构化布线成为网络设计和管理的首先考虑的问题,当实施结构化布线时,需要进行详细的规划设计。
问答题分析以下有关ISDN网络的特点,回答下面问题。【说明】ISDN的提出最早为了综合电信网的多种业务网络。由于传统通信网是业务需求推动的,所以各个业务网络如电话网、电报网和数据通信网等各自独立且业务的运营机制各异,这样对网络运营商而言运营、管理、维护复杂,资源浪费;对用户而言,业务申请手续复杂、使用不便、成本高;同时对整个通信的发展来说,这种异构体系对未来发展适应性极差。于是将话音、数据、图像等各种业务综合在统一的网络内成为一种必然,这就是综合业务数字网(IntegratedServicesDigitalNetwork)的提出。
问答题试题一(共20分)阅读以下说明,回答问题1至问题4,将解答填入答题纸对应的解答栏内。【说明】某企业网络拓扑如图1-1所示,A~E是网络设备的编号。
问答题【说明】现有两台cisco路由器,现在要求实现router1和router2联通并且要有md5认证。有认证的情况下实现两台路由器的互联,这两台路由器必须配置相同的认证方式和密钥才能进行双方的路由的交换,双方必须发送版本2。router1(config)#keychainwanrouter1(config-keychain)#key1router1(config-keychain-key)#key-stringwanrouter1(config-keychain-key)#exitrouter1(config-keychain)#exitrouter1(config)#interfaceeth0/0router1(config-if-eth0/0)#ipripauthenticationkey-chainwanrouter1(config-ig-eth0/0)#ipripauthenticationmodemd5(1)router1(config-if-eth0/0)#ipripsendversion2(2)router1(conflg-if-eth0/0)#ipripreceiveversion2(3)坚实和维护rip {{B}}表2.4{{/B}}作用命令 {{U}}(4){{/U}} {{U}}showipripdatabase{{/U}} 显示rip的debug状态 {{U}}showdebuggingrip{{/U}} {{U}}(5){{/U}} {{U}}showipprotocolsrip{{/U}} debug输出rip数据报文信息 showipprotocolsrip debug输出rip数据住信息事件 debugiprippacket{send|receive} debug输出rip的rim信息 debugiprippacketrm显示ip数据库信息router#showipripdatabasenetworknexthopmetricfromtimerip182.0.5.0/247192.168.0.210(6)1192.168.1.20002:40(7)rip?182.0.6.0/24192.168.0.2101192.168.1.20002:40connected192.168.0.0/24(8)rip193.100.98.0/24192.168.0.2361192.168.0.23602:53
问答题阅读以下说明,回答下面问题。【说明】VPN是通过公用网络Internet将分布在不同地点的终端联接而成的专用网络。目前大多采用IPsec实现IP网络上端点间的认证和加密服务。
